Now about a used set, they come up on Ebay fairly often. I would be wary of a used set, because the reeds all come from John perfectly adjusted; however I've run across a number of people with Walsh smallpipes where they've mucked with the reeds and ruined their adjustment. Why anyone would do this I cannot imagine.
In fact every time I've ever come across somebody with a John Walsh set that wasn't playing right it was because they mucked with the reeds. In other words every John Walsh set I've come across where the owner has NOT mucked with the reeds played perfectly.
